CIEGO DE AVILA, Cuba, Jul 3 (ACN) A vacationer visiting Jardines del Rey will enjoy its installations, many of them repeaters, to the destination for the quality of its services and personalized attention.
Maria Atzeva and Lolita Ramkohar, from Toronto and Montreal, respectively are some of those clients that return to the keys north of the central province of Ciego de Avila to get together after having met in the tourism destination and became friends.
They have in common, in the majority of the cases, the Hotel Iberostar Daiquiri and both expressed favorable opinions of the installation, safety and good conditions for their enjoyment.
Lolita visits the Cuban keys four times a year; she has visited many hotels in the region but prefers Daiquiri and recommends it to all of her friends and working colleagues.
She was able to see the damages inflicted by Hurricane Irma in the region in photos and appreciated the quick recovery and improvement to many of the sites.
Maria visited the tourism complex for the first time six years ago when decided to change her destination originally to Mexico after recommendations of Jardines del Rey on TripAdvisor, she said.
She praised the friendliness of the personnel at Daiquiri and characterized them as nice and always with a smile on their faces, very distinctive of the site and reason to return.
The Iberostar Daiquiri was inaugurated on December 2nd, 1998, with a 43.6 percent rate of its visitors repeating their stay mainly from Canada, Britain and Argentina.
During the months of July and August the Cuban nationals visit the keys, mainly from Sancti Spiritus, Cienfuegos and Camaguey.
